A moving lights factory represents a sophisticated manufacturing facility dedicated to producing intelligent lighting systems that revolutionize entertainment and architectural illumination. These specialized production centers focus on creating automated lighting fixtures that combine precise mechanical movement with advanced LED technology, enabling dynamic light shows and versatile illumination solutions. The moving lights factory integrates cutting-edge engineering processes to manufacture fixtures capable of pan, tilt, zoom, and color-changing functions through sophisticated motor systems and control electronics. Modern moving lights factory operations utilize automated assembly lines equipped with precision robotics to ensure consistent quality and performance standards across all produced units. The facility incorporates comprehensive quality control systems that test each fixture's mechanical accuracy, optical performance, and electronic reliability before distribution. Advanced moving lights factory environments feature dedicated research and development departments that continuously innovate new features such as wireless connectivity, smartphone integration, and energy-efficient designs. The manufacturing process within a moving lights factory encompasses multiple specialized departments including mechanical engineering for precise movement systems, optical engineering for lens and reflector optimization, and electronic engineering for control circuit development. Quality assurance protocols in every moving lights factory ensure products meet international safety standards and performance specifications required for professional entertainment venues, architectural installations, and commercial applications. The facility's production capabilities extend beyond basic manufacturing to include custom design services, enabling clients to specify unique requirements for specialized applications. Environmental sustainability remains a priority for modern moving lights factory operations, implementing eco-friendly manufacturing processes and developing energy-efficient products that reduce power consumption while maintaining superior performance standards.

Advanced Manufacturing Technology Integration

The moving lights factory leverages state-of-the-art manufacturing technology that sets new standards for precision and reliability in intelligent lighting production. Sophisticated computer-controlled machinery ensures micron-level accuracy in mechanical component fabrication, resulting in smooth movement operations and extended service life for every fixture. The facility employs advanced surface-mount technology for electronic circuit assembly, creating compact and robust control systems that withstand demanding environmental conditions while maintaining consistent performance. Automated optical alignment systems within the moving lights factory guarantee perfect lens positioning and beam quality, eliminating variations that could affect light output uniformity across production batches. The integration of artificial intelligence in quality control processes enables real-time defect detection and correction, ensuring only products meeting the highest standards reach customers. Precision injection molding equipment produces lightweight yet durable housing components that protect internal mechanisms while facilitating efficient heat dissipation. The moving lights factory utilizes specialized testing chambers that simulate extreme operating conditions, validating product performance across temperature ranges, humidity levels, and vibration scenarios typical in professional entertainment environments. Advanced color calibration systems ensure accurate color reproduction and consistency across all manufactured units, critical for applications requiring precise color matching. The facility's implementation of lean manufacturing principles minimizes waste while maximizing efficiency, resulting in cost-effective production that benefits both the manufacturer and end customers. Continuous monitoring systems track every aspect of the production process, enabling immediate adjustments to maintain optimal quality standards and production efficiency throughout daily operations.

Comprehensive Quality Assurance Systems

The moving lights factory implements comprehensive quality assurance protocols that exceed international standards, ensuring every product delivers exceptional performance and reliability throughout its operational lifetime. Multi-stage inspection processes begin with incoming material verification, where specialized equipment analyzes components for dimensional accuracy, electrical specifications, and material properties before approval for production use. In-process quality monitoring utilizes advanced measurement systems that continuously verify manufacturing parameters, immediately identifying and correcting deviations that could affect final product quality. The facility's dedicated testing laboratory conducts extensive performance evaluations including photometric analysis, mechanical stress testing, and electronic functionality verification using calibrated instruments traceable to international standards. Environmental stress screening procedures within the moving lights factory subject products to accelerated aging tests that simulate years of operational use, identifying potential failure modes before products reach customers. Electromagnetic compatibility testing ensures all fixtures comply with international EMC regulations, preventing interference with other equipment and ensuring reliable operation in complex electronic environments. The quality assurance program includes statistical process control methods that analyze production data trends, enabling proactive improvements to manufacturing processes and product designs. Third-party certification programs validate the moving lights factory's adherence to ISO quality standards and industry-specific requirements, providing customers with confidence in product reliability and manufacturer credibility. Traceability systems track every component and process step, enabling rapid identification and resolution of any quality issues while providing valuable data for continuous improvement initiatives. Customer feedback integration allows the quality assurance team to incorporate real-world performance data into testing protocols, ensuring laboratory conditions accurately reflect actual operating environments.
